The following commit has been merged in the master branch:
commit d2ebe520d257eca7adb0a0425c7cf571a176f3eb
Author: Raphael Geissert <[email protected]>
Date:   Sun Feb 22 02:19:25 2009 -0600

    Test the malformed-override and unused-override checks

diff --git a/t/COVERAGE b/t/COVERAGE
index 52ba949..a14b368 100644
--- a/t/COVERAGE
+++ b/t/COVERAGE
@@ -457,8 +457,6 @@ init.d preinst-calls-updaterc.d
 init.d prerm-calls-updaterc.d
 
 lintian bad-ubuntu-distribution-in-changes-file
-lintian malformed-override
-lintian unused-override
 
 manpages bad-link-to-undocumented-manpage
 manpages binary-without-english-manpage
diff --git a/t/tests/lintian-overrides/debian/debian/overrides 
b/t/tests/lintian-overrides/debian/debian/overrides
new file mode 100644
index 0000000..1250c8c
--- /dev/null
+++ b/t/tests/lintian-overrides/debian/debian/overrides
@@ -0,0 +1,2 @@
+lintian-override: 
+lintian-overrides: say hi :)
diff --git a/t/tests/lintian-overrides/debian/debian/rules 
b/t/tests/lintian-overrides/debian/debian/rules
new file mode 100755
index 0000000..a611d72
--- /dev/null
+++ b/t/tests/lintian-overrides/debian/debian/rules
@@ -0,0 +1,13 @@
+#!/usr/bin/make -f
+
+pkg=lintian-overrides
+
+%:
+       dh $@
+
+binary:
+       dh binary --before install
+       install -D -m 0644 $(CURDIR)/debian/overrides \
+               $(CURDIR)/debian/$(pkg)/usr/share/lintian/overrides/$(pkg)
+       dh_fixperms
+       dh binary --remaining
diff --git a/t/tests/lintian-overrides/desc b/t/tests/lintian-overrides/desc
new file mode 100644
index 0000000..622076a
--- /dev/null
+++ b/t/tests/lintian-overrides/desc
@@ -0,0 +1,7 @@
+Testname: lintian-overrides
+Sequence: 6000
+Version: 1.0
+Description: Test the couple of overrides-related tags
+Test-For:
+ malformed-override
+ unused-override
diff --git a/t/tests/lintian-overrides/tags b/t/tests/lintian-overrides/tags
new file mode 100644
index 0000000..dd04745
--- /dev/null
+++ b/t/tests/lintian-overrides/tags
@@ -0,0 +1,2 @@
+E: lintian-overrides: malformed-override lintian-override:
+I: lintian-overrides: unused-override say hi :)

-- 
Debian package checker


-- 
To UNSUBSCRIBE, email to [email protected]
with a subject of "unsubscribe". Trouble? Contact [email protected]

Reply via email to